Muthoga, Gaturu & Co. [MG&Co.] was established on 11th June 1975 by the two founding partners, Judge Lee G. Muthoga SC and Mr. Evans T. Gaturu. Currently, the firm comprises of Seven (7) Partners, Six (6) Associates and a number of paralegal secretarial and management staff. The partners are:

John is a Senior Partner, and the current Managing Partner. He heads the Firm’s Commercial Law and Conveyancing Department.  He was admitted to partnership in January 1986 and specialises in property transfers, securities documentation, cross border Mergers and Acquisitions, transnational transactions, corporate finance and international labour law. John has significant practical experience in these areas, having been the Lead Counsel on most of the consultancies the Firm has undertaken. Patrick is a Senior Partner, and is the current head of the Firm’s Litigation and ADR Department. He is a seasoned litigator, and also a qualified professional Arbitrator. He is the Firm’s leading expert in Arbitration and ADR, and has extensive experience in national and international arbitrations. James is a Partner in the Firm’s Litigation and ADR Department. He was admitted into the Firm’s partnership in January 2001, and mandated to restructure its branch office at Nyeri to give it a modern and corporate image in line with the Firm’s vision and mission, a task he successfully completed. James is presently the Partner in charge of the Firm’s ICT Committee charged with developing the ICT department and competencies. James has significant experience in litigation, having specialised in court ligation. He is a Member of the Chartered Institute of Arbitrators, and represents clients in arbitral proceedings.

Rugo is a Partner in the Firm’s Commercial Law and Conveyancing Department. He was admitted into partnership in January, 2011. He was previously with the Firm from his admission to the Roll of Advocates on 25th May, 2000 until July, 2005, when he joined the Kenya Anti-Corruption Commission, and subsequently the firm of Chiuri Kirui & Rugo, Advocates until 31st December, 2010. Rugo has extensive experience in commercial and corporate law practice, in particular cross border acquisitions and mergers, corporate restructurings and reorganizations, joint ventures, and advising start-up and early stage businesses. Mugambi is the Resident Partner in charge of the Firm’s branch office at Nyeri. He was admitted into partnership in January, 2009. Besides being in charge of the Firm’s branch’s administration, Mr. Mugambi has been in charge of non-litigious legal work as well active litigation in a wide variety of legal issues ranging from Criminal Law, Divorce & Family Law, Employment Law, Contract and Commercial Litigation, Succession and Land Law. Catherine is a Partner in the Firm’s Commercial Law and Conveyancing Department. She was admitted into partnership in January 2011. She has extensive experience in commercial law, including transfer of businesses and assets, joint ventures, incorporation of companies and all related issues, and legal advisory services to co-operative societies and non-governmental organizations.
